The Evolution of Ledgers from Stone Tablets to Digital Natives

Ledgers have been the financial backbone of commerce for millennia. Historically, they were physical books where businesses meticulously recorded transactions. In the digital era, ledgers have evolved significantly. Blockchains, at their core, serve as distributed ledgers that allow for secure, transparent, and instant recording of transactions across a network.

Digital ledgers offer a radical shift in how we manage and perceive finances. They are not only an immutable record of transactions but, when utilized effectively, they also provide the immediate data that is vital to today's businesses.

The Immediate Visibility that Drives Decision-Making

Waiting for monthly, quarterly, or annual financial reports to assess performance and make strategic choices is an outdated approach. Real-time ledgers offer immediate visibility into financial activity, allowing executives and financial analysts to stay abreast of current conditions.

For instance, sales data that is immediately recorded in a ledger can alert teams to rising demand for certain products, triggering faster inventory management decisions and more responsive supply chain adjustments. Similarly, real-time cost tracking enables tighter control over expenditures, with the ability to spot and rectify budget overruns well before the month-end report.

Protecting Your Profit Margins with Instant Data

In a world where market dynamics can shift in hours, the ability to quickly gauge and respond to profitability is paramount. Leveraging a ledger system that updates in real time provides businesses with the tools to monitor margins, track price fluctuations, and identify cost-saving opportunities as they arise.

Immediate access to financial data also supports proactive fraud detection and risk management. Suspicious transactions can be flagged and investigated without delay, safeguarding your financial assets and maintaining market trust.

The Crucial Role of Real-Time Ledgers in Compliance and Reporting

Regulatory requirements are increasingly demanding real-time or near-real-time financial disclosures. The advent of frameworks like Making Tax Digital (MTD) in the UK is a prime example of how regulatory reporting is moving toward a real-time basis. Real-time ledgers equip businesses to not only comply with such mandates but to do so efficiently and effectively, reducing the risk of non-compliance penalties.
